Who Can Resist Pygmy Goats?

Visiting Grant’s Farm usually does not cross my mind when thinking of what to do on a beautiful Saturday morning but that is exactly what Bob, Kim and I did last weekend. I would have to say it’s been at least 15 years since I’ve been there and the only thing I remembered about that experience was feeding the goats, so I had no idea what to expect when we got there.

Since Grant’s Farm is the home of the Anheuser-Busch Clysdales, we had to go see them.

Then we got on the tram for a brief tour of the bison, elk, donkeys and various hoofed animals.

Finally, we reached the main attraction, the pygmy goats! You pay $1 per bottle of milk to feed these little cuties. Don’t let their bellies fool you, they will still eat. And boy, are they aggressive about it. There was this one who kept ramming me in the back of the leg with his horns. They may be small, but they are feisty and I have the bruises to prove it.

But we all loved every minute of it. The STL101 List is right, even the grumpiest person cannot resist the adorableness.

22. Feed the pygmy goats in the Tier Garten at Grant’s Farm, Affton’s 281-acre wonderland. The wee things’ hilariously single-minded devotion to gorging themselves—they’re little more than stomachs with legs—will lighten even the gloomiest mood. We kid you not.
